Career Path
In the UK, the holistic fashion industry is rapidly growing and offers various exciting career paths.
According to recent studies, the demand for holistic fashion professionals is increasing, and job market trends show promising prospects.
Here are the top 5 roles in the holistic fashion industry, along with their respective popularity, skill demand, and salary ranges. 1.
Fashion Designer (25%) ------------------------- *Create unique and sustainable garments, accessories, and textiles.* - Average salary: Β£25,000 - Β£40,000 - Skills in demand: sketching, sewing, patternmaking, knowledge of textiles and fabrics, sustainability practices 2.
Fashion Buyer (20%) --------------------- *Curate a collection of garments and accessories to sell in a retail store or online platform.* - Average salary: Β£20,000 - Β£40,000 - Skills in demand: negotiation, market research, trend forecasting, product development, financial management 3.
Fashion Merchandiser (15%) ---------------------------- *Plan, coordinate, and manage inventory levels, floor space, and visual merchandising.* - Average salary: Β£18,000 - Β£35,000 - Skills in demand: retail mathematics, visual merchandising, marketing, sales analysis, product development 4.
Fashion Marketer (20%) ------------------------- *Promote fashion brands, products, and services through various marketing channels and strategies.* - Average salary: Β£20,000 - Β£50,000 - Skills in demand: digital marketing, content creation, social media management, communication, data analysis 5.
Fashion Technologist (20%) ----------------------------- *Integrate technology into fashion design, manufacturing, and retail processes.* - Average salary: Β£25,000 - Β£60,000 - Skills in demand: computer programming, data analysis, 3D design, digital textile printing, e-commerce, IoT integration
